THE LOCALITY AND AMENITIES
Killarney is without a doubt one of the finest tourist towns and most beautiful places in the world. The Killarney area provides unparalleled beauty to please the eye and soothe the mind. In it's 25,000 acres of National Park you will find lakes, rivers, mountains, wildlife and walks where all year round you can commune with Nature without interruption.
The Town itself provides an incredible range of beautiful shops, leisure activities and entertainment that will help you relax and unwind throughout the day and night and a huge selection of restaurants to tempt your taste buds.
LOCAL ACTIVITIES
- Golf: With its world famous golf courses including Killeen and O’Mahony’s Point, Killarney truly is a Golfer’s paradise. Other famous Kerry courses such as Ballybunion, Ring of Kerry, Kenmare, Dooks and Tralee are all within a short drive of Killarney.
- Leisure Centres: Killarney is home to a huge number of Leisure Centres, many of which offer daily and weekly membership to families. Please enquire directly with us.
- Pony Trekking: A very popular activity in Killarney. Two of the most popular routes are through the National Park and the Gap of Dunloe Trek.
- Jaunting Cars: Killarney is famous for its horse-drawn Jaunting Cars which offer the visitor a novel means of touring the sights.
- Fishing: The Killarney Lakes are three in number, Lough Leane, Middle Lake and Upper Lake, all of which are excellent for salmon and brown trout. Boats and ghillies can be arranged.
- Cycling: Killarney is the perfect place for cycling and bikes are available for hire on a daily or weekly basis.
- Walking: Killarney provides both the rambler and serious walker with the ultimate in diversity.The choice of walks is endless and includes the Kerry Way walking route and Ireland's highest peaks -MacGillycuddy's Reeks.
VISITOR ATTRACTIONS:
** Killarney National Park -Just a two minute drive from Muckross Holiday Village is Killarney National Park which consists of 25,000 acres of lakes, rivers, mountains, wildlife and walks where all year round you can commune with nature without interruption.
** Ring of Kerry -A trip to Killarney would not be complete without taking in the Ring of Kerry scenic drive around the Iveragh Peninsula taking you through such quaint and picturesque towns as Killorglin, Cahirsiveen, Waterville, Sneem and Kenmare.
